Nelly Korda Interviewed by Sister Jessica After 4 Under at Amundi Evian Championship on Thursday

In the world of professional golf, sibling dynamics have always provided unique insights and memorable moments. Nelly Korda, one of the top players on the LPGA Tour, recently showcased her skills at the Amundi Evian Championship, shooting a remarkable four-under-par on Thursday. Following her impressive performance, Nelly sat down with her sister Jessica Korda for an in-depth interview, discussing the highlights of her round, her strategies, and what it means to compete at such a high level. The Bond Between the Korda Sisters

During their conversation, the unique bond between Nelly and Jessica Korda became evident. Their camaraderie goes beyond being competitive golfers; it shapes their experiences on and off the green. Jessica, who is also an accomplished golfer, expressed her pride in Nelly’s achievements and the way she handles the pressures of the game. “I think it’s incredible that we both get to share this journey,” Jessica said. “We support each other through the ups and downs, and that’s invaluable.”
This camaraderie was palpable as they discussed what it’s like to compete at the highest level. Jessica reminisced about their childhood experiences on the golf course and how those moments helped them develop their passion for the game. “Growing up, we were always pushing each other to be better, and that has shaped our careers,” she noted.
